//
// SpinRow.swift
// Adwaita
//
// Created by auto-generation on 26.10.24.
//
import CAdw
import LevenshteinTransformations
/// An [class@ActionRow] with an embedded spin button.
///
/// <picture><source srcset="spin-row-dark.png" media="(prefers-color-scheme: dark)"><img src="spin-row.png" alt="spin-row"></picture>
///
/// Example of an `AdwSpinRow` UI definition:
///
/// ```xml
/// <object class="AdwSpinRow"><property name="title" translatable="yes">Spin Row</property><property name="adjustment"><object class="GtkAdjustment"><property name="lower">0</property><property name="upper">100</property><property name="value">50</property><property name="page-increment">10</property><property name="step-increment">1</property></object></property></object>
/// ```
///
/// See [class@Gtk.SpinButton] for details.
///
/// ## CSS nodes
///
/// `AdwSpinRow` has the same structure as [class@ActionRow], as well as the
/// `.spin` style class on the main node.
///
/// ## Accessibility
///
/// `AdwSpinRow` uses an internal `GtkSpinButton` with the
/// `GTK_ACCESSIBLE_ROLE_SPIN_BUTTON` role.
public struct SpinRow: AdwaitaWidget {
/// Additional update functions for type extensions.
var updateFunctions: [(ViewStorage, WidgetData, Bool) -> Void] = []
/// Additional appear functions for type extensions.
var appearFunctions: [(ViewStorage, WidgetData) -> Void] = []
/// The widget to activate when the row is activated.
///
/// The row can be activated either by clicking on it, calling
/// [method@ActionRow.activate], or via mnemonics in the title.
/// See the [property@PreferencesRow:use-underline] property to enable
/// mnemonics.
///
/// The target widget will be activated by emitting the
/// [signal@Gtk.Widget::mnemonic-activate] signal on it.
var activatableWidget: (() -> Body)?
/// The acceleration rate when you hold down a button or key.
var climbRate: Double
/// The number of decimal places to display.
var digits: UInt
/// Whether non-numeric characters should be ignored.
var numeric: Bool?
/// Whether invalid values are snapped to the nearest step increment.
var snapToTicks: Bool?
/// The subtitle for this row.
///
/// The subtitle is interpreted as Pango markup unless
/// [property@PreferencesRow:use-markup] is set to `FALSE`.
var subtitle: String?
/// The number of lines at the end of which the subtitle label will be
/// ellipsized.
///
/// If the value is 0, the number of lines won't be limited.
var subtitleLines: Int?
/// Whether the user can copy the subtitle from the label.
///
/// See also [property@Gtk.Label:selectable].
var subtitleSelectable: Bool?
/// The title of the preference represented by this row.
///
/// The title is interpreted as Pango markup unless
/// [property@PreferencesRow:use-markup] is set to `FALSE`.
var title: String?
/// The number of lines at the end of which the title label will be ellipsized.
///
/// If the value is 0, the number of lines won't be limited.
var titleLines: Int?
/// Whether the user can copy the title from the label.
///
/// See also [property@Gtk.Label:selectable].
var titleSelectable: Bool?
/// Whether to use Pango markup for the title label.
///
/// Subclasses may also use it for other labels, such as subtitle.
///
/// See also [func@Pango.parse_markup].
var useMarkup: Bool?
/// Whether an embedded underline in the title indicates a mnemonic.
var useUnderline: Bool?
/// The current value.
var value: Binding<Double>?
/// Whether the spin row should wrap upon reaching its limits.
var wrap: Bool?
/// This signal is emitted after the row has been activated.
var activated: (() -> Void)?
/// Emitted to convert the user's input into a double value.
///
/// The signal handler is expected to use [method@Gtk.Editable.get_text] to
/// retrieve the text of the spinbutton and set new_value to the new value.
///
/// The default conversion uses [func@GLib.strtod].
///
/// See [signal@Gtk.SpinButton::input].
var input: (() -> Void)?
/// Emitted to tweak the formatting of the value for display.
///
/// See [signal@Gtk.SpinButton::output].
var output: (() -> Void)?
/// Emitted right after the spinbutton wraps.
///
/// See [signal@Gtk.SpinButton::wrapped].
var wrapped: (() -> Void)?
/// The body for the widget "suffix".
var suffix: () -> Body = { [] }
/// The body for the widget "prefix".
var prefix: () -> Body = { [] }
/// Initialize `SpinRow`.
public init(climbRate: Double, digits: UInt) {
self.climbRate = climbRate
self.digits = digits
}
/// The view storage.
/// - Parameters:
/// - modifiers: Modify views before being updated.
/// - type: The view render data type.
/// - Returns: The view storage.
public func container<Data>(data: WidgetData, type: Data.Type) -> ViewStorage where Data: ViewRenderData {
let storage = ViewStorage(adw_spin_row_new(nil, climbRate, digits.cInt)?.opaque())
for function in appearFunctions {
function(storage, data)
}
update(storage, data: data, updateProperties: true, type: type)
if let activatableWidgetStorage = activatableWidget?().storage(data: data, type: type) {
storage.content["activatableWidget"] = [activatableWidgetStorage]
adw_action_row_set_activatable_widget(storage.opaquePointer?.cast(), activatableWidgetStorage.opaquePointer?.cast())
}
var suffixStorage: [ViewStorage] = []
for view in suffix() {
suffixStorage.append(view.storage(data: data, type: type))
adw_action_row_add_suffix(storage.opaquePointer?.cast(), suffixStorage.last?.opaquePointer?.cast())
}
storage.content["suffix"] = suffixStorage
var prefixStorage: [ViewStorage] = []
for view in prefix() {
prefixStorage.append(view.storage(data: data, type: type))
adw_action_row_add_prefix(storage.opaquePointer?.cast(), prefixStorage.last?.opaquePointer?.cast())
}
storage.content["prefix"] = prefixStorage
return storage
}
/// Update the stored content.
/// - Parameters:
/// - storage: The storage to update.
/// - modifiers: Modify views before being updated
/// - updateProperties: Whether to update the view's properties.
/// - type: The view render data type.
public func update<Data>(_ storage: ViewStorage, data: WidgetData, updateProperties: Bool, type: Data.Type) where Data: ViewRenderData {
if let activated {
storage.connectSignal(name: "activated", argCount: 0) {
activated()
}
}
if let input {
storage.connectSignal(name: "input", argCount: 1) {
input()
}
}
if let output {
storage.connectSignal(name: "output", argCount: 0) {
output()
}
}
if let wrapped {
storage.connectSignal(name: "wrapped", argCount: 0) {
wrapped()
}
}
storage.modify { widget in
storage.notify(name: "value") {
let newValue = adw_spin_row_get_value(storage.opaquePointer)
if let value, newValue != value.wrappedValue {
value.wrappedValue = newValue
}
}
if let widget = storage.content["activatableWidget"]?.first {
activatableWidget?().updateStorage(widget, data: data, updateProperties: updateProperties, type: type)
}
if updateProperties, (storage.previousState as? Self)?.climbRate != climbRate {
adw_spin_row_set_climb_rate(widget, climbRate)
}
if updateProperties, (storage.previousState as? Self)?.digits != digits {
adw_spin_row_set_digits(widget, digits.cInt)
}
if let numeric, updateProperties, (storage.previousState as? Self)?.numeric != numeric {
adw_spin_row_set_numeric(widget, numeric.cBool)
}
if let snapToTicks, updateProperties, (storage.previousState as? Self)?.snapToTicks != snapToTicks {
adw_spin_row_set_snap_to_ticks(widget, snapToTicks.cBool)
}
if let subtitle, updateProperties, (storage.previousState as? Self)?.subtitle != subtitle {
adw_action_row_set_subtitle(widget?.cast(), subtitle)
}
if let subtitleLines, updateProperties, (storage.previousState as? Self)?.subtitleLines != subtitleLines {
adw_action_row_set_subtitle_lines(widget?.cast(), subtitleLines.cInt)
}
if let subtitleSelectable, updateProperties, (storage.previousState as? Self)?.subtitleSelectable != subtitleSelectable {
adw_action_row_set_subtitle_selectable(widget?.cast(), subtitleSelectable.cBool)
}
if let title, updateProperties, (storage.previousState as? Self)?.title != title {
adw_preferences_row_set_title(widget?.cast(), title)
}
if let titleLines, updateProperties, (storage.previousState as? Self)?.titleLines != titleLines {
adw_action_row_set_title_lines(widget?.cast(), titleLines.cInt)
}
if let titleSelectable, updateProperties, (storage.previousState as? Self)?.titleSelectable != titleSelectable {
adw_preferences_row_set_title_selectable(widget?.cast(), titleSelectable.cBool)
}
if let useMarkup, updateProperties, (storage.previousState as? Self)?.useMarkup != useMarkup {
adw_preferences_row_set_use_markup(widget?.cast(), useMarkup.cBool)
}
if let useUnderline, updateProperties, (storage.previousState as? Self)?.useUnderline != useUnderline {
adw_preferences_row_set_use_underline(widget?.cast(), useUnderline.cBool)
}
if let value, updateProperties, (adw_spin_row_get_value(storage.opaquePointer)) != value.wrappedValue {
adw_spin_row_set_value(storage.opaquePointer, value.wrappedValue)
}
if let wrap, updateProperties, (storage.previousState as? Self)?.wrap != wrap {
adw_spin_row_set_wrap(widget, wrap.cBool)
}
}
for function in updateFunctions {
function(storage, data, updateProperties)
}
if updateProperties {
storage.previousState = self
}
}
